01 - Dissolve the strawberry gelatin in 1 cup boiling water, stirring until completely dissolved. Stir in 1 cup cold water. Pour into a shallow dish and refrigerate for 1 hour or until fully set.
02 - Repeat the process with lemon gelatin: dissolve in 1 cup boiling water, add 1 cup cold water, pour into a separate shallow dish, and refrigerate for 1 hour until set.
03 - In a mixing bowl, beat the heavy whipping cream with an electric mixer until soft peaks form. Set aside.
04 - In another bowl, beat cream cheese, sugar, and vanilla extract until smooth and creamy. Gently fold in the whipped cream until well combined.
05 - Once both gelatins are fully set, cut them into 1/2-inch cubes using a knife.
06 - Place a spoonful of the cream cheese mixture in the bottom of each jar. Add a layer of strawberry gelatin cubes, some diced strawberries, and a few mini marshmallows.
07 - Add another layer of cream cheese mixture, followed by lemon gelatin cubes, diced pineapple, and more mini marshmallows.
08 - Finish with a final spoonful of cream cheese mixture on top of each jar.
09 - Refrigerate the assembled jars for at least 1 hour to allow flavors to meld and set.
10 - Before serving, top each jar with whipped cream, place a marshmallow bunny candy on top, and sprinkle with pastel sprinkles.
